Private car service is worth more when pickup location, vehicle class, wait policy, and a day-of contact path need to be clear.
A strong guide should also tell you when taxi, rideshare, Metro, FlyAway, or self-drive is a better answer.
Start with the trip. The right provider for a solo ride across town may be wrong for LAX, a production call, a roadshow, or a wedding.
The important comparison is not just price. It is the tradeoff between cost, luggage friction, pickup control, and how much of the final handoff can be planned before confirmation.

In Los Angeles, the hard part is often the handoff: LAX outer curb, hotel canopy, residence gate, FBO lobby, venue release, or production lot. A car service should solve that before pickup.
When an assistant, planner, producer, or family office is booking for someone else, a reviewed quote and contact path are more valuable than a one-click ride.
If the rider is solo, light-luggage, flexible, and personally managing the pickup, taxi, rideshare, transit, or self-drive may be sufficient.
The best choice depends on the trip. Concierge-reviewed private car service is stronger for airports, executives, events, FBOs, groups, and coordinator-managed rides. Taxi, transit, or rideshare can be better for simple flexible trips.
Cost depends on route, vehicle class, wait time, airport or parking costs, hourly minimums, stops, date demand, cancellation terms, and gratuity treatment.
Use private car service when luggage, timing, Disneyland or Irvine schedules, or cross-county traffic make coordination valuable. Self-drive or rideshare may work for flexible trips.
